chalk up

verb

Definition of CHALK UP

1
to explain (something) as being the result of something else <let's chalk up her weird behavior to simple nervousness>
Related Words blame, charge, father (on), impute (to), pin (on); assign, refer; associate, attach, connect, link
2
to obtain (as a goal) through effort <chalked up a record in singles tennis that is likely to stand for a long time>
Synonyms attain, bag, chalk up, clock (up) [chiefly British], gain, hit, log, make, notch (up), rack up, ring up, score, win
Near Antonyms fall short (of), miss; fail (at); lose
